William Sr. and Jr. are listed as members of the South Fork Baptist Church in 1852.There is also an entry dated October 29, 1853 noting a 'grievance' between William and Owen.I have heard undocumented stories that it involved the theft or shooting of livestock.
Where did you get your information on Samuel?The often-repeated story is that his parents married in 1741 in Boston.I believe all of the other Trivettes who fought in the revolution came from the large Trevett clan that started in the Boston area in the mid-1600's.This Samuel's unit, the 2nd Virgina Regiment, was on loan to the Continental Army and served with Washington at Valley Forge.
